Transaction 56f501037396adf7b4e6a49644159fc08f546b59797f451d294313f61cdfb82b

1 Input
2 Outputs
  • 56f501037396adf7b4e6a49644159fc08f546b59797f451d294313f61cdfb82b:0
  • value  50136
    address  16v8m5Bt7gtdDQpH7fahnw4rRh8jbHRNUK
  • 56f501037396adf7b4e6a49644159fc08f546b59797f451d294313f61cdfb82b:1
  • value  2889122
    address  1exdSN7u9QBeeRwf5KccyqoVcoVG1PEaa